Overrated 8/12/2004

Have the people who say Lombardi's is the best NY pizza actually eaten there? I was so excited to try it, having been a totonno's addict for many years. Not only is is not as good -- it's not even close. Both have great crust, though Totonno's is a little lighter and thinner. The sauce at Lombardi's was more acidic, but the biggest difference was the cheese. At Totonno's it has some tang to it, with a little bit of baked parmesan on top. Lombardi's fresh mozzarella was bland, flavorless. Toppings-wise, Lombardi's garlic meatballs were terrible, sliced too thick and overdone. Beyond that, the menu at totonno's is amazing, great salads, egglant parm, penne vodka. Lombardi's salad dressing is so heavy on the vinegar it brings tears to your eyes. Lombardi's doesn't hold a candle to totonno's and has rested on its laurels for too long ... Pros: upstairs patio Cons: , bad sauce, weak menu items more
